The mining shaft towers are true icons of Beringen's mining past. Lighting with different lighting scenarios, adapted to the time of year, enhances its presence in the night-time landscape.

The mining shaft towers dominate the scene with metal lattice structures and shapes, icons of Beringen’s heritage, integral to the colliery’s unique character.

Lighting boosts their geometry, ensuring efficiency and sustainability: Narrow beam projectors near the main pillars’ bases, emphasize verticality and structural depth; floods ensure cost-effectiveness and low-maintenance, crucial preservation factors.

Minimizing eco-impact, lighting is carefully focused and at full capacity only in early darkness, ensuring significant nocturnal presence, while answering eco-concerns and the site’s historical story.
